56611880 has 32 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 137176200. Its totient is φ = 20902656.
The previous prime is 56611879. The next prime is 56611889. The reversal of 56611880 is 8811665.
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in 4 ways, for example, as 37724164 + 18887716 = 6142^2 + 4346^2 .
It is a self number, because there is not a number n which added to its sum of digits gives 56611880.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(56611889)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 7 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 53915 + ... + 54954.
Almost surely, 256611880 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
56611880 is an abundant number, since it is smaller than the sum of its proper divisors (80564320).
It is a pseudoperfect number, because it is the sum of a subset of its proper divisors.
56611880 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
56611880 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 108893 (or 108889 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 11520, while the sum is 35.
The square root of 56611880 is about 7524.0866555350. The cubic root of 56611880 is about 383.9746257828.
The spelling of 56611880 in words is "fifty-six million, six hundred eleven thousand, eight hundred eighty".
